CRYSTAL STRUCTURE OF GLMU FROM HAEMOPHILUS INFLUENZAE IN COMPLEX WITH QUINAZOLINE INHIBITOR 2
About this Structure
2w0w is a 1 chain structure with sequence from Haemophilus influenzae.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
